What kind of change does this PR introduce?
Introduces a way to pass options to the PostgrestQueryBuilder instance on a per-request basis.
What is the current behavior?
There is no way to specify per-request options currently.
supabase/supabase-js#438
What is the new behavior?
An optional parameter is introduced that can be passed to the
.frommethod, where users can optionally specify customfetchandheadersoptions.
